Understanding the Provisioning Performance Schedule
The Provisioning Performance Schedule is a crucial document in federal contracts, serving to outline the performance and delivery timeline for contractors. This government contract form is significant because it ensures that parties adhere to agreed-upon schedules and benchmarks throughout the project. It includes specific sections that detail the necessary dates, events, and actions required for project tracking, contributing to successful contract execution.
By utilizing the Provisioning Performance Schedule, contractors can systematically monitor their obligations, fostering an environment of accountability and clarity in government contracting.

Key Features of the Provisioning Performance Schedule
This performance schedule template includes several notable features that simplify the completion process for users. It contains fillable fields and checkboxes, making it user-friendly and efficient for contractors to complete. Additionally, it mandates signatures from authorized personnel, specifically the Contractor Program Manager and the AF Prov Chairperson, which verifies the authenticity of the submission.
These features not only improve accuracy but also facilitate the necessary validation required in federal contracting processes.

Who needs to sign the Provisioning Performance Schedule?
The Provisioning Performance Schedule requires signatures from the Contractor Program Manager and the AF Prov Chairperson. Their signatures confirm the accuracy of the information and adherence to contract specifications.
What is the purpose of the Provisioning Performance Schedule?
The purpose of the Provisioning Performance Schedule is to clearly outline the performance and delivery schedule for government contracts, ensuring all parties are aligned on dates, events, and responsibilities.
Is notarization required for this form?
No, notarization is not required for the Provisioning Performance Schedule. However, both required signatures must be completed to validate the document.
